Why Deck 12 mid-ship cabins have a smell issue on embarkation day

Carnival Cruise Line · Carnival Celebration · Deck 12, Cabin 12088
The Galley GhostAnonymous

Worked culinary on Celebration. Deck 12 mid-ship on the port side is directly above the main galley ventilation exhaust. On embarkation days when we're running all stations simultaneously prepping for the first dinner, those cabins get a food smell — usually bread and industrial cleaning products — for about 3-4 hours from 11am to 2pm. After that it's completely fine for the rest of the sailing. I've seen guests request room changes on embarkation afternoon thinking something is wrong with the room. Nothing is wrong. It just smells like a bakery for a few hours. If you're checking in early it's a thing to know.
